While many are still waiting to see if The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t will receive new official content in 2026, the community has once again shown that the game is still very much alive. And it’s doing so in a way that few expected: with a fan-created expansion that introduces full cooperative gameplay to the world of Geralt of Rivia.
The proposal doesn’t just stop at a one-time activity or an experimental mode, but rather adapts the entire game structure to be enjoyed with company, including main quests, side quests, and free exploration of the map.
How The Witcher 3’s cooperative mode works on PC
The mod, called The Witcher Online, can be downloaded for free from NexusMods and adds a new section to the main menu where you can create multiplayer sessions or join existing servers. Each player can customize their character, adjust their gear, and explore the world with other users in real-time.
Among its most notable features are text and voice chat, emoji use, social encounters in taverns, and cooperative combat against open-world enemies. All of this is supported by a redesigned interface to make the experience feel natural and not disrupt the game’s usual rhythm.
Additionally, the mod is compatible with other community creations, such as the popular Chill Out expansion, which further expands the possibilities.
